(Are you) sure?: ¿(Está) seguro?
(-Can I borrow your car?) -Sure: (-¿Puedes prestarme tu coche?) -Claro.
for sure: cierto, seguro
En el registro informal, el adverbio "sure", sinónimo de "surely", "certainly", se puede usar solo.
It sure is going to be a hot day. Va a ser con toda seguridad un día muy cálido.
